5 Best Mookata Restaurants in Singapore As Recommended by Thais

With so many mookata restaurants in Singapore —owned by both Thais and even Chinese— and reviews on the web, how do we know which ones really make the mark? We asked our Thai friends living in Singapore and sussed out the best mookata restaurants according to them. 

Below, the top five places to go to for your Thai steamboat barbecue fix: 

1. Cheese Story

Source: Cheese Story | Facebook

Singaporeans love anything with cheese, as evident by the plethora of cheese KBBQ options in Singapore. Now, the cheese trend has made its way to mookata and successfully captured the taste buds of Thai themselves. Cheese Story Mookata Buffet at Golden Mile Complex reigns as one of the preferred cheese mookata places around, due to the generous servings of cheese dips they offer. The cheese is also grilled in a separate compartment on the stove — perfect for achieving that luscious cheese pull! Our Thai recommender, Adelina, frequents Cheese Story as her favourite restaurant because of their cheese dips and affordable price. 

Location: 5001 Beach Road Golden Mile Complex #02-01

Opening hours: 3pm-6am (Mon-Thurs), 12pm-6am (Fri-Sun)

Price: $29.90 (Adult), $15.90 (Child). Additional $3 for adults on Fri-Sun, eve of PH AND PH

Recommended by: Adelina Teo (half-Thai living in SG for 9 years)

2. Siam Square Mookata

Source: Siam Square Mookata | Facebook

Siam Square Mookata is considered one of the few mookata pioneers in Singapore, so you can trust them to bring an authentic taste. There are several Siam Square locations in Singapore, but our Thai recommender, Nuttawe, frequently patronises the one at Golden Mile Tower — one being the location, and another being the variety of food they have. Find a selection of over 70 food items including meat and seafood, four types of signature chilli sauces, as well as free ice cream! Select outlets also carry draft beer from Phuket. 

Source: Siam Square Mookata | Facebook

Location: Full list of locations here

Opening hours: Various timings for every outlet 

Price: A la carte pricing from $1.80/plate, $29/person for buffet 

Recommended by: Nuttawe Muneerat (Thai living in SG for 4 years)

Food item worth mentioning: Pork belly

3. New Udon Moo-Kata

Source: New Udon Moo-Kata | Facebook

Yet another mookata restaurant in Golden Mile that makes the list — for New Udon, they’re known for their beautifully seasoned meats and extra sweet Thai milk tea. Choose from platter sets that come with a variety of seafood, meat, vegetables and glass noodles. They also have their own in-house made chilli sauce. Our Thai recommender, Chula, especially loves the juiciness of the grilled meats. 

Source: New Udon Moo-Kata | Facebook
Source: Sing-navi.net

Location: 5001 Beach Rd, #01-66E Golden Mile Complex

Opening hours: 11am-9pm 

Price: From $45 for a 2 pax set 

Recommended by: Chula Srikamma (Thai living in SG for 2 years)

Food item worth mentioning: Grilled pork, chicken

4. ORTO Mookata

Source: ORTO | Facebook

For those concerned about smelling bad after a mookata session, head to ORTO. The restaurant’s dedicated exhaust system ensures you get the same smoky indulgence minus the stinky odour. What’s more, food is cooked from a large traditional charcoal pot instead of a gas stove. Our Thai recommender, Walkacha, especially likes how the charcoal pot retains the rustic experience and fragrance of mookata. He recommends that everyone “should try at least once” for an authentic Thai mookata experience. He also likes how the pot skillet is also large enough to ensure meat doesn’t slide into the soup — something I’m sure almost everyone struggles with. 

Source: ORTO | Facebook

Location: 81 Lor Chencharu, Singapore 769198

Opening hours: 5pm-12am (Mon-Thu), 5pm-1am (Fri), 12pm-1am (Sat), 12pm-12am (Sun)

Price: $25.90++ (Mon-Thu), $28.90++ (Sat-Sun)

Recommended by: Walkacha Phimtong (Thai living in SG for 11 years)

Food item worth mentioning: Pork belly and collar 

5. Bangkok Street Mookata

Source: Bangkok Street Mookata | Facebook

Bedok may be commonly associated with hawker food (Bedok 85, we’re looking at you), but did you know they have a fantastic mookata place as well? Bangkok Street Mookata is as close as you can get to eating in BKK, especially with their affordable prices. A set for two here would set you back about $22 — that’s slightly above $10 per person each. Our Thai recommender, Nuttawe, especially likes that for that price, you get a good mix of fresh seafood such as king prawns, scallops, slipper lobster and lots more. She’s also a fan of their authentic extra spicy homemade chilli sauce! 

Source: Bangkok Street Mookata | Facebook

Location: 88 Bedok North Street 4, #01-125, Singapore 460088

Opening hours: 5pm-3am 

Price: From $10/pax

Recommended by: Nuttawe Muneerat (Thai living in SG for 4 years)

Food item worth mentioning: Smoked duck
